RazorSQL for Mac 是一款强大的跨平台多功能SQL数据库编辑器,能够连接到30多种不同类型的数据库,并允许您浏览其内容,执行SQL查询或执行各种管理功能。您可以使用RazorSQL从数据库导入或导出数据,比较数据库中的数据等。它是一款强大的跨平台实用软件,旨在简化和快速查询,导航和管理大量数据库格式。
RazorSQL软件下载完成后,打开软件包如上图,请参照 Mac版RazorSQL数据库软件安装说明 进行安装即可。
下面列出了RazorSQL的主要功能。RazorSQL用户界面为用户提供了浏览数据库对象和结构、执行SQL查询和语句、搜索数据库对象和数据、编辑数据库表、创建和更改数据库对象等功能。
按菜单分组的功能参考-RazorSQL中每个菜单选项的详细信息。
数据库特定功能-每个数据库提供的功能的详细信息,如MySQL、Oracle、PostgreSQL、DB2、MS SQL Server、Salesforce、Sybase、SQLite、Athena、Aurora、BigQuery、Cassandra、Derby、Druid、DynamoDB、Firebird、H2、Hive、HSQLDB、Informix、Ingres、Interbase、Cache、kdb+、MariaDB、MS Access、MongoDB、MonetDB、Pervasive、Redshift、SimpleDB、Snowflake、SQL Anywhere,SQL Azure、Teradata、Vertica等。
高级连接功能-RazorSQL可以连接到数据库的各种方式。
数据库和SQL工具-RazorSQL提供的各种工具
SQL编辑器-RazorSQL中包含的SQL编辑器的功能。
数据库浏览器-RazorSQL中包含的数据库浏览器的功能。
内置数据库-RazorSQL中包含的内置关系数据库的功能。
内置支持Athena、Aurora(MySQL和PostgreSQL)、BigQuery、Cassandra、Couchbase、DB2、Derby/JavaDB、Druid、DynamoDB、Firebird、FrontBase、Greenplum、H2、HBase、Hive、HSQLDB、Informix、Ingres、Interbase、Intersystems Cache、kdb+、MariaDB、MS Access、MongoDB、MonetDB、MySQL、OpenBase、Oracle、Pervasive、PostgreSQL、Redshift、Salesforce、SimpleDB、Snowflake、SQLite、SQL Server,SQL Azure、Sybase Adaptive Server Enterprise、Sybase IQ、Sybase SQL Anywhere、Teradata、Vertica和VoltDB。还可以连接到任何支持JDBC或ODBC的数据库。
MySQL、PostgreSQL和MS SQL Server PHP桥,用于通过PHP连接到MySQL、PostgresSQL和SQL Server数据库。允许远程访问在启用PHP的web服务器后面运行的MySQL、PostgreSQL或SQL Server数据库
一个MS SQL Server ASP桥,用于通过ASP连接到SQL Server数据库。允许远程访问在启用ASP的web服务器后面运行的SQL Server数据库
RazorSQLJDBC桥,用于通过JEE/J2EE应用服务器或Servlet容器连接到数据库
创建、修改和删除表和视图
复制/备份表
创建和删除索引和序列
创建和删除存储过程、函数、包和触发器
创建和删除数据库和用户
一种多表数据库数据搜索工具
搜索数据库对象的工具
编辑存储过程、函数、包和触发器
用于将数据库表从一种类型转换为另一种类型的数据库转换工具
描述表格和视图
生成DDL工具,用于生成表、视图和索引DDL。
查看表和视图的内容
查看存储过程、函数、包和触发器的内容
用于选择、插入、更新和删除语句的SQL查询生成器
以文本、HTML、XML、Excel、分隔文件格式或插入语句形式导出数据
将数据从分隔文件、Excel文件或固定宽度文件导入表
执行存储过程
SQL解释计划工具
SQL查询计划程序
比较表数据或查询结果
文件比较工具
用于查看/提取Zip和Jar文件的Zip实用程序
文件系统浏览器
数据库元数据查看器(函数、类型等)
命令行接口,用于从命令行运行RazorSQL工具。
SQL、PL/SQL、TransactSQL、SQL PL、Batch、C、COBOL、CSS、C++、C#、Java、JavaScript、JSP、HTML、PHP、Perl、Python、Ruby、Shell脚本和XML的语法突出显示
表和列的自动完成
自动列查找
自动表格查找
SQL格式化程序
支持参数化查询
执行、执行全部提取和执行批处理功能
查询结果的多表格显示
可排序查询结果
可筛选查询结果
可搜索查询结果
所有查询的SQL历史记录,以及每个连接的查询日志记录
所有支持的编程语言的自动函数查找以及Java和JSP的自动方法查找
查询列表、标记列表和函数/方法列表选项,用于可点击显示编辑器中包含的查询、标记或函数/方法
文件工具,如head、tail、get section、search/regex search、move、copy、rename、delete、size和get info。
用于将常用查询快速方便地插入编辑器的SQL收藏夹
一键式填充用户定义文本的提前键功能
正则表达式在文件中查找、查找/替换、查找/更换
括号匹配、标记匹配和转到行命令
对编辑器内容和查询结果的打印支持
支持数十种文件编码
内置和自定义用户模板
连接保持活动
插件API(允许用户向RazorSQL添加自定义功能)
用于导航数据库对象的树结构
使用RazorSQL提供的特定于数据库的系统查询或用户提供的查询进行数据库导航,或者使用默认的JDBC/ODBC驱动程序设置导航数据库结构。
单击即可查看表、视图等上的内容。
列信息,包括列名、键、数据类型、可为null的信息等。
显示有关对象的信息,例如过程、函数、触发器、索引、约束、序列等。
单击生成用于表、视图和索引的DDL。
搜索表和查看数据。
单击生成SQL选择、插入、更新和删除查询。
不需要最终用户配置
立即连接到强健的数据库
使用强大的HSQLDB数据库引擎